TAMPA, Fla., April 19, 2017 -- The board of directors of HCI Group, Inc. (NYSE:HCI), a holding company primarily engaged in providing homeowners insurance, with operations also in reinsurance, real estate and information technology, has declared a regular quarterly cash dividend in the amount of 35 cents per common share for the second quarter of 2017.
The dividend will be paid June 16, 2017 to shareholders of record on the close of business May 19, 2017.
About HCI Group, Inc.
HCI Group, Inc. owns subsidiaries engaged in diverse, yet complementary business activities, including homeowners’ insurance, reinsurance, real estate and information technology. The company's largest subsidiary, Homeowners Choice Property & Casualty Insurance Company, Inc., is a leading provider of property and casualty insurance in the state of Florida.
The company's common shares trade on the New York Stock Exchange under the ticker symbol "HCI" and are included in the Russell 2000 and S&P SmallCap 600 Index.
